Game Preview: Essex Rebels vs Manchester Basketball

April 24, 2026

Saturday 25th April | 16:00 | Essex Sport Arena

The Essex Rebels return to the Essex Sport Arena to take on Manchester Basketball in their final Super League Basketball fixture of the regular season — and the stakes couldn’t be higher.


This is a defining game for the Rebels, with league position on the line. A win would guarantee a top four finish and the possibility of a historic third-place finish — the highest in club history — while also securing home-court advantage in the play-offs for the first time since joining the top women’s league.

Having put together three big victories in a row after a difficult period that included losses against the Oaklands Wolves and the Caledonia Gladiators, the Rebels are hitting form at exactly the right time and will be looking to carry that momentum into the post-season.

Revenge will also be on their minds after suffering a 97–88 loss in the reverse fixture earlier this year. Despite strong offensive performances — including 27 and 22 points from Natalie Chou and Quinesha

Lockett respectively — the Rebels were unable to hold off Manchester.

This weekend’s visitors currently sit sixth in the league table, level on points (14) with the London Lions. With three losses in their last four SLB matches, Manchester Basketball will be eager to finish their season on a high.


Player To Watch: Frannie Hottinger

A dynamic and impactful forward, the Rebels will need no introduction to Frannie Hottinger this weekend. In the previous meeting between the two sides, Hottinger delivered an outstanding performance, recording 26 points, five rebounds, and three assists. She was also perfect from the free-throw line (12/12), meaning discipline will be key for the Rebels in limiting her impact.

Across the league season, Hottinger is averaging 17.6 points per game, along with 7.1 rebounds.
